I will always remember the little frisson I had, one morning in 1989, when I opened the newspaper and read ”Zita, Last Empress of Austria-Hungary, Dead at 96.”

It felt like some kind of bulletin from a lost world.

Ever since, I’ve had a sneaking fondness for her.

Today marks the 150th anniversary of the birth of that gift to the writing of comic poetry, Queen Marie of Roumania.

A granddaughter of Queen Victoria, she leapt into her role as Crown Princess and then Queen of her country's still-new royal family, playing a significant role in Balkan politics...
